2025 Compare Cities Overview:
Portage, MI vs Buffalo Grove, IL

Change Cities
Highlights
Are people in Buffalo Grove older or younger than people in Portage?
- The Median Age in Buffalo Grove is 4.2 years older than in Portage.

Are housing costs cheaper in Buffalo Grove or Portage?
- Buffalo Grove housing costs are 32.7% more expensive than Portage housing costs.

Which city has a longer commute, Buffalo Grove or Portage?
- The average commute for residents of Buffalo Grove is 10.2 minutes longer than it is for residents of Portage.

Things to do in Portage?
Portage, MI is a peaceful community located in Kalamazoo County near Lake Michigan. Home to numerous parks and recreational areas including Celery Flats Historical Area and Portage Creek Bicentennial Park, Portage provides its residents with plenty of outdoor resources perfect for activities like disc golfing at Milham Park Golf Course or fishing on Pigeon River Country State Game Area. In addition, there are many restaurants, unique shops and other amenities that make living here so enjoyable. Whether you’re looking for rural serenity or just want easy access to nearby cities — Portage has something for everyone!

Things to do in Buffalo Grove?
Buffalo Grove, Illinois lies within Cook County giving its citizens access to top rated schools such as Stevenson High School while also having shopping options at Arbor Town Square and numerous restaurants such as Tamarind By Maurya Indian Cuisine

 Portage, MIBuffalo Grove, ILUnited States
 Population  Unlock43,062329,725,481
 Median Income$68,755  Unlock$69,021
 Median Age  Unlock41.238.4
 Avg. Home Price$252,100  Unlock$338,100
 Unemployment Rate  Unlock4.2%6.0%
 Avg. Commute Time19.43  Unlock26.38
Reviews for Portage    3 Reviews

I'm just writing because I think that the people who are in my opinion bashing Kalamazoo, really don't know anything about it. I have vacationed in much larger cities,  More

   |    Reply

Before I moved to Portage in 2007, I didn't have any real breathing problems. I had a minor case of hay fever. I moved here and I am stuck inside most of the summer  More

   |    Reply

Over 20 years ago

Portage is a nice palce to live and raise a family. I don't think it would be a good place for a single  More

   |    Reply

Start Your Review of Portage

Reviews for Buffalo Grove    7 Reviews

Over 11 years ago

Numerous forest preserve areas with walking paths and places to play sports (baseball, soccer, football). Close driving distance to Lake Michigan and several  More

   |    Reply

nice town to raise a  More

   |    Reply

Over 17 years ago

No place is perfect however BG is at or near the top especially in schooling and crime prevention. Numerous parks and biking paths. A great place to raise a family safe  More

   |    Reply

Start Your Review of Buffalo Grove


Premium Subscription
Includes Cost of Living compares for child care, utilities, transportation, health, taxes, housing for home owners vs renters, weather, insurance premiums and so much more.


The premier source for comprehensive city data for over 30 years.

© Best Places. All rights reserved.